Description

9-Cyclopentyladenine monomethylsulfonate (9-CP-Ade mesylate) is a stable non-competitive adenylate cyclase inhibitor with cell permeable properties[1][2].

In Vitro

9-Cyclopentyladenine monomethanesulfonate (200 μM, 30 min) inhibits the activation of cAMP response element binding protein (CREB) and completely blocks neurogenesis in PC12 cells[1].
9-Cyclopentyladenine monomethanesulfonate (100 μM, 30min) attenuates the effect of relaxin on mechanical activity and prevents relaxin-induced hyperpolarization thereby being involved in the regulation of relaxin on ileal smooth muscle activity in female CD1 Swiss mice[2].
9-Cyclopentyladenine monomethanesulfonate (100 μM, 6 hours) promotes restoration of the keratinocyte permeability barrier by inhibiting the synthesis of cAMP in male hairless mice[3].

Molecular Weight

299.35

Formula

C11H17N5O3S

CAS No.
Appearance

Solid

Color

White to off-white

SMILES

NC1=C2N=CN(C3CCCC3)C2=NC=N1.CS(=O)(O)=O

Shipping

Room temperature in continental US; may vary elsewhere.

Storage

-20°C, sealed storage, away from moisture

*In solvent : -80°C, 6 months; -20°C, 1 month (sealed storage, away from moisture)

Solvent & Solubility
In Vitro: 

DMSO : 41.67 mg/mL (139.20 mM; ultrasonic and warming and heat to 60°C; Hygroscopic DMSO has a significant impact on the solubility of product, please use newly opened DMSO)
